Fine, IrvingSerious Song: A Lament for String Orchestra (1955) 10'


Repertoire Note  


Fine called this ten-minute work, commissioned and premiered by the Louisville Philharmonic Orchestra, "essentially an extended aria for string orchestra." Its moods shift between passion and tenderness, desperation and serenity. Its musical materials demonstrate the composer's fascination with modal harmonies and third-related keys. Framing the middle section in C minor are opening and closing sections centered on E sometimes major, sometimes minor and other times Phrygian in mode.
